Absence of eigenvalues for the generalized two-dimensional periodic Dirac operator

Mathematical Physics 2007-05-23 v1 math.MP Spectral Theory

Abstract

A generalized two-dimensional periodic Dirac operator is considered, with LL^{\infty}-matrix-valued coefficients of the first order derivatives and with complex matrix-valued potential. It is proved that if the matrix-valued potential has zero bound relative to the free Dirac operator, then the spectrum of the operator in question contains no eigenvalues.
